Home News SPRING SOWING TO BE INCREASED BY 15-20 PERCENT IN REGARD WITH THE PANDEMIC SPRING SOWING TO BE INCREASED BY 15-20 PERCENT IN REGARD WITH THE PANDEMIC Minister of Food, Agriculture and Light Industry Ch.Ulaan worked at a crop farming zone last weekend, getting acquainted with progress of spring sowing. This year, 478 thousand hectares of areas are planned for cultivation, including 384.2 thousand hectares for grains of which 356.8 thousand hectares for wheat, 38.2 thousand hectares for fodder plants, 41 thousand hectares for oil plants, 14.9 thousand hectares for potatoes, 9.2 thousand hectares for vegetables and 7.3 thousand hectares for fruits and berries. However, in regard with special situation of the pandemic, the Government resolved to increase spring sowing by 15-20 percent. “The Ministry of Food, Agriculture and Light Industry is working together with farmers and vegetable growers to increase spring sowing by 15-20 percent in regard with special situation of the pandemic. The Ministry will focus on ensuring preparation of cultivation well, immediately organizing works to provide necessary equipment and devices, seed, fuel, fertilizer and plant protection products to farmers at preferential condition through Agriculture Promotion Fund and providing soft loan of MNT 150 billion with 3-5 percent interest rate to farmers through the Development Bank of Mongolia to make supply of wheat, potatoes, vegetables, fodder and oil plants, fruits and berries stable. We are grateful to our farmers and vegetable growers, who are backing up the Government policy to create food reserves and to increase sowing to ensure domestic need,” Minister Ch.Ulaan said.
